SZA Shares Her Unreleased Verse On Justin Bieber’s Yukon

SZA shocks fans by releasing her unreleased verse on Justin Bieber’s “Yukon,” sparking calls for the full collaboration to be officially released.

Music Twitter woke up confused, excited and slightly feral today because SZA just dropped a bomb out of nowhere. She shared her unreleased verse on Justin Bieber’s song Yukon, a collaboration that fans didn’t even know existed.

In classic SZA fashion, she didn’t tease it, she didn’t hype it, she didn’t even explain it. She simply posted the audio snippet online, and the internet has not taken a breath since.
